Hi All,
I have recently sold my property which has commercial and resiendential tenants, some of them are tenant for 30 years . Is it a mandate that I have to send them a legal notice stating that I have sold the property and new landlord can do whatever he wants with the property?
I have already discussed it with 2 advocates, they said that it is not a mandate and if requried the new landlord can himself send them notice stating that he has bought the property. The only problem I see here is that in the registry it is mentioned that the notice would be sent by me.
Can you please advise?

bhagwat patil
(Expert) 31 May 2011
If it is mentioned in registry then you have to send the notice.Merely sending a notice will not harm you,as you are not liable for giving vacant possession,let the new owner pursue the matter.

Devajyoti Barman
(Expert) 31 May 2011
Whether you send a notice or not, it would make no difference.
In any case it is the duty of the new landlord to send the letter of attornment to the tenant.
